## FuelLedger Plugin Releases

Plugins for FuelLedger, the fleet fuel-usage reporting suite, are distributed through the Harrowgate plugin registry. Each submitted plugin package is validated against the current schema and rebuilt in a clean environment before listing. Unsigned packages are rejected automatically, so sign your bundle before upload. Version numbers must follow the documented scheme. To verify that your toolchain targets the correct release channel, use the signing key below.

signing key of bagap-yawep = bky13_TbfT6ZMUoGJo2

## Authentication

Heads up: the nightly reindex job (`reindex_nightly.py`) talks to the Lanternfish search cluster, and that cluster won't accept anonymous writes anymore — we locked it down last sprint. The job now authenticates as the `reindex-runner` service identity against Corvid Gateway, and the token is injected via the `LF_INDEX_TOKEN` env var in the scheduler config. Nothing clever going on, just a bearer header on every batch request. For review purposes, the staging credential currently in use is listed below.

service key, kadug-kadup: kto15_rN23XLAYImmZgrJ

- [ ] Step 7: Archive cold storage buckets (Glacierline tier). Confirm both ceremony witnesses are present, verify bucket manifests match the Oxbow ledger, then seal the archive key shares. Plugin authors may observe but not handle shares. Once sealed, the archive index itself is encrypted and can only be reopened with the passphrase below.

vault phrase of badup-hahig = tamael-aldael-kelmir-istael-fenok-istwyn-tamius-jorath-oliion

Hey — welcome to the Crumbline on-call rota! One thing to know before you review my PR: the bakery order-cutoff rule. Orders for next-day pickup close at 18:00 shop-local time, but the Provery scheduler evaluates cutoffs in UTC, so there's a conversion shim in OrderGate you'll see touched in the diff. Don't "simplify" it, please — we broke Saturday croissants twice that way. The rule spec and edge cases are written up on the internal page here:

wiki page, tahaf-tajog: https://jira.ordindyn.corp/pipeline